Summary of the role:
The CFO is responsible for financial reporting, performance, accounting operations, and compliance with all financial regulations and procedures. S/he will ensure a high service to clients and other stakeholders and take responsibility for and lead the company’s day-to-day financial and accounting requirements. Produce the monthly financial management information pack, budget and forecast preparation, internal control policies and financial risk management. The CFO will report to the Executive Director.
Responsibilities & Duties:
- Manage all accounting operations, including A/R, A/P, GL and Revenue Recognition
- Ensure all financial transactions are properly recorded, filed and reported
- Oversee the preparation and publishing of timely financial statements and other regulatory reporting
- Coordinate and direct the preparation of the budget and financial forecasts and report variances
- Coordinate month-end and close year-end process
- Create monthly and annual reports to identify results, trends, and financial forecasts;
- Manage cash flow by tracking transactions and regularly reviewing internal reports;
- Establish and implement financial reporting systems to comply with accounting standards, rules and regulations, taxes, policy, and procedures;
- Standardize and streamline accounting operations
- Implement proper internal controls, coordinate audit processes, and ensure the accuracy of financial information.
- Implement corporate governance procedures and risk management controls
- Overseeing monthly, quarterly and annual Financial Reporting.
- Prepare the statement of accounting policies for the audited financials in compliance with the IFRS.
- Ensuring all reports adhere to Accounting standards, rules, regulations, local filing requirements and accounting best practices.
- Developing financial analysis tools to assist in monitoring budgets and compliance
- Develop and maintain the compliance review strategies, plans, initiatives and processes.
- Supervising audits of processes and controls by ensuring conclusions are accurate, complete, and discussed with management promptly.
- Development and implementation of a formal Risk Management Framework
- Ensuring compliance with CIT, VAT, and other local taxes.
- Evaluating systems and processes to identify opportunities for improvement
